Common Webalizer.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to webalizer.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to webalizer.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Webalizer.exe has Stopped Working: This error message shows up when the executable file is unable to function properly. This could be due to a variety of reasons such as software bugs, conflicts with other programs, or system resource issues.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): Although not strictly an webalizer.exe error, certain .exe files can cause system instability leading to a BSOD, indicating a fatal system error.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This warning surfaces when there's an issue with an application starting up correctly. This might be due to issues within the application, corruption of related files, or problems associated with the Windows registry.
  • Missing Webalizer.exe File: This alert comes up when the system is unable to locate the necessary executable file. Webalizer.exe could have been removed, relocated, or the provided file path might be incorrect.
  • Webalizer.exe File Not Executing: Sometimes, despite double-clicking an .exe file, the program might not start. This could be due to incorrect file permissions, system issues, or conflicting software.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
4
Description

How to use the Windows Check Disk Utility. Scans your disk for webalizer.exe errors and automatically fix them.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the webalizer.exe problem persists.
